Arduino is an opensource electronics prototyping platform based on flexible, easytouse hardware and software. First of all i want to thank my partners in the arduino team. The other way to affect the arduino adc resolution is to use a different reference voltage. David cuartielles, david mellis, gianluca martino, and tom igoe. This is, i believe, the best way to learn a subject and especially a subject like physical computing, which is what the arduino is all about. Language reference the text of the arduino reference is licensed under a creative commons attributionsharealike 3. Diese seite ist auch in 2 anderen sprachen verfugbar. Add strings, arrays and functions to your wonderful sketches.
Arduino reference overview name description advanced io overview advanced io analog io overview analog io arithmetic operators. Here is the list of some arduino programming book context that allows you to. Users can also constrain a number within a range, remap a number from one range to another, and calculate the value of a number raised to a power. There are varieties of arduinos available and the most common. Arduino free book for beginners random nerd tutorials.
The arduino development environment comes with many example sketches programs that guide a beginner through both the language and circuit. Learn the basics of arduino uno from the board to its software. This library allows for the calculation of minmax, absolute value and the square root of a number. Im extending some code that i found online to work on the gyroscope that im building. This means that you can copy, reuse, adapt and build upon the text of this book noncommercially while a. Heres some code to highlight the craziness thats going on.
The reference voltage is the fullscale voltage applied to the adc converter operating as described above. The arduino mkr 485 shield will provide the industrial connectivity you need. This page is currently inactive and is retained for historical reference. It contains an atmel avr microcontroller specifically the atmega328 a usbtoserial interface, five volt voltage regulator, and various support electronics. Internet of things with arduino blueprints is a projectbased book that begins with. The pow function can operate on integer or floatingpoint values and it returns the. Sep 20, 2016 the largest collection of arduino books free pdf download, arduino books, arduino pdf, free pdf, free download pdf, free arduino books, arduino board, arduino code, lcd arduino, processing arduino, stay safe and healthy.
We will use the two words interchangeably in this book. Barbara ghella, she doesnt know, but, without her precious advice, arduino and this book might have never happened. Fashionable prototyping and wearable computing using the. Arduino internals also suggests alternative programming environments, since many arduino hackers have a background language other than c or java. Join the tens of thousands of hobbyists who have discovered this incredible and educational platform.
Of course, it is possible to optimize the way in which hardware and software interactan entire chapter is dedicated to this field. Arduino free book for beginners this guys earthshine electronics have produced a great arduino tutorial. Programming arduino book enables you to learn how to use analog and digital inputsoutputs in a particular program. A beginners arduino guidearduino language wikibooks. Pow can be used to raise a number to a fractional power. Its helpful to keep your wire color consistent red for pow er, black for ground.
To revive discussion, seek broader input via a forum such as the village pump. On each book page you will find information about the book, including where appropriate code and errata for the book. Readers with no electronics experience can create their first gadgets within a few minutes. The credit cardsized arduino board can be used via the internet to make useful and interactive internet of things iot projects. The text of the arduino projects book is licensed under a creative commons a. Learn about basic electronics and the common components used in arduino projects and electronic. Arduino wearable projects design code and build exciting wearable projects book of 2015. Arduino the arduino is an open source micro controller board used for electronic prototyping. Written for the absolute beginner with stepbystep instructions. Arduino is an opensource platform that makes diy electronics projects easier than ever. The arduino can receive data from sensors used to collect information in its soundings and it can be used to control other electronic components as lights, motors and more. So lets use some brain cells and at least try returning a double.
This is an option in the adc mux see diagram below take an adc reading of the bandgap voltage arduino voltage reference. Reference pow, exp, log, log10 calculates the value of a number raised to a power or logarithm of a value. This book is uptodate for the new arduino uno board, with stepbystep instructions for building a universal remote, a motionsensing. Exponential function read 16446 times previous topic next topic. Arduino sketches tools and techniques for programming wizardry book of 2015. Im wondering what the difference is between pow and sqrt in this code. Either the page is no longer relevant or consensus on its purpose has become unclear.
For a better result calibrate the arduino voltage reference. This is useful for generating exponential mapping of values or curves. The l led is on the arduino directly behind the usb connection 1. See the extended reference for more advanced features of the arduino languages and the. Basic arduino connections quick reference guide make. Secure your arduino uno to the base using 3 screws.
Like its predecessors, the uno is an allinone development board. As you gladly tear away the packaging you notice a small book that feels like it was printed on 4th generation recycled newspaper its the instruction. Arduino programs can be divided in three main parts. Say you changed the vref value to 1v then the minimum lsb you could detect would be 11024 or. Please practice handwashing and social distancing, and check out our resources for adapting to these times. Arduino programming language can be divided in three main parts. Corrections, suggestions, and new documentation should be posted to the forum. Each book has a page which you can access buy clicking on the book s cover image. Included in the book are 17 arduino practice projects which include printable templates. Written by the cofounder of the arduino project, with illustrations by elisa canducci, getting started with arduino gets you in on the. Structure in arduino, the standard program entry point main is. As you learn more and gain new skills youll probably want to expand, and add more electronics books, and in the process learn more about electronics and engineering in general, there are some books here that are recommended for that as well. Arduino is the ideal open hardware platform to experiment with the world of internet of things. The largest collection of arduino books arduino books.
How to use this book the book starts with an introduction to the arduino, how to set up the hardware, install the software, upload your. Reference language extended libraries comparison board. The arduino language is the set of words, expressions and rules that are used to create arduino sketches. Explore the full range of official arduino products including boards, modules, shields and kits, for all ability levels and use cases. There are an abundance of arduino books, and these make for a great introduction. The text of the arduino reference is licensed under a creative commons attributionsharealike 3. To figure out a value of the supply voltage using the arduino voltage reference.
The arduino programming language reference, organized into functions, variable and constant, and structure keywords. Oreilly books may be purchased for educational, business, or sales. Gsm3g board to get your products online worldwide in seconds. Im not the best at arduino so im sorry for my noobiness. To use the introductory examples in this book, all you need is a usb arduino, usb ab cable, and an led. Code samples in the reference are released into the public domain. The arduino pow reference explicitly states that these values must be passed as floats and returned as doubles. Arduino official store boards shields kits accessories. A few moments on the arduino web site plus the ide sketches and you will have effectively read this book. Standard library extensions v3 library fundamentals ts v3. Thanks for contributing an answer to stack overflow. The text of the zuno reference is based on arduino reference and is.
643 343 144 1301 422 1069 1462 969 86 384 121 237 1116 1279 203 1318 635 918 203 410 1159 1138 501 1022 686 428 344 1367